4ws

What do you need to put 4ws on a fifth gen??? Can you just use the fourth gens rear end or is it contolled by the ECU? Just fyi

It would be easier to get the parts designed for the 5th Gens - JDM, Aussies and Europe all offered 4ws.

get the parts designed for the 5th gen, but it has nothing to do with the ECU, there is a seperate computer for it.

If you are interested in a 4ws conversion on a 5th gen, do a search under my posts for 4ws. I researched this, and you'd be better off trying to import a 5th gen 4ws from another country. It is NOT an easy job, and you need a ****load more than just a rear rack and computer.
